Lowry Dialysis Center

Phone
(303) 367-0946
Fax
(303) 367-0951
7465 East 1st Avenue Ste A, Denver, CO 80230

Directions to 7465 East 1st Avenue Ste A, Denver, CO 80230

From:

To: